The Miami Marlins selected outfielder/third baseman Jacob Berry with the sixth overall pick in the 2022 MLB draft. The 21-year-old played college baseball at LSU last year and hit .370/.464/.630 with 15 homers, 48 RBI and 47 runs over 53 games. He is a switch hitter and has shown the ability to hit for contact and power from both sides of the plate. He has some defensive concerns as he lacks ideal speed for the outfield and has been described as "too rigid" for third base. He could wind up being a first baseman or primarily a designated hitter in the majors. Either way, he's someone who could help the Marlins sooner rather than later as he's further along than many other prospects who were taken at the top of this year's draft.--Andrew Ericksen - RotoBallerRead More News
